logo

Output 3de07b91b9d30c189e518e9020660732e5517f930af1f011a8d57499dec9f0eb:2

value
2622701178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10354fc33f9a8e15a7b577edf80a7e249a704354 OP_EQUAL
address
33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r
transaction
3de07b91b9d30c189e518e9020660732e5517f930af1f011a8d57499dec9f0eb